Seepage-proof cement
The invention discloses seepage-proof cement and belongs to the technical field of building materials. The seepage-proof cement comprises the following components in parts by weight: 15-25 parts of aluminophosphate cement soil, 7-8 parts of aluminium silicate, 0.5-1.3 parts of a melamine resin, 0.2-1.4 parts of N-N-dimethyl pyrrolidone, 0.2-1.5 parts of sodium dodecyl sulfate, 1-5 parts of asbestos powder, 0.3-1.5 parts of a quaternary ammonium bis-imidazoline corrosion inhibitor, 0.5-1.8 parts of a sulfonated-pheno-formoldehyde resin, 10-15 parts of calcium aluminate. 5-10 parts of glass fibers and 0.8-1.7 parts of urea. In the hydration process of the cement, hydrogen bonds are formed between the molecules of organic matters and the molecules of inorganic matters to reduce pores, and meanwhile, hydrophobic substances in the material can effectively produce a lotus effect, so that the seepage-proof cement has excellent seepage-proof property.
